Everyone will have a death of Lazarus experience; no one is exempt. A death of Lazarus experience represents an experience that’s unimaginable. Jesus loved Lazarus and would surely be there for him. After all, he healed strangers, hadn’t he? Yet, He let Lazarus die. Why? Aren’t believers to experience a life of love, peace, joy and victory? Why does God allow these situations in our lives if He loves us? We simply can’t wrap our minds around them. It seems more than we can bear. Some Christians don’t make it through the weeping of the night, to experience the joy that comes in the morning! What we really believe about God and ourselves will be revealed during times of trial. The challenge is not simply to get through the test but about our attitudes during the process. Our faith is always on trial and as Christians, we represent our Lord and Savior Jesus Christ. God’s Glory is to be our ultimate goal. The question is, how do we do it? The author shares relevant insights on how to deal with life’s most difficult challenges through personal life experiences; for he knows that peace is not the absence of trouble, but the presence of Christ in its midst.
